Divorced and Disfigured, Now Married to a Zillionaire

Divorced and Disfigured, Now Married to a Zillionaire

For years, Liliana "Lilly" Lewiston lived a life defined by silence. A gifted ballerina forced into the background, she played the dutiful wife to Victor McCallum while her twin sister, Alina, lived as the family’s golden child. Lilly was the invisible scapegoat, used for her blood, her reputation, and her compliance, until she was finally deemed useless and discarded. Framed for a crime she didn't commit, pregnant, and left for dead in the freezing rain, Lilly was certain her end had come. But she didn’t die. Sabistan Rhys Hart, the cold, egmatic, and devastatingly powerful uncle of the man who destroyed her. He doesn’t offer pity; he offers a deal. A marriage of convenience designed to secure her vengeance and ignite her rise to power. Sabistan is a man of few words and ruthless instincts, but there is a fire in him that only burns for Lilly. As she sheds her mask and reclaims her place on the stage, she transforms from the timid, broken girl into a force of nature that will bring the McCallum empire to its knees. But as the lines between revenge and passion blur, Lilly faces a dangerous truth. She is falling for the only man who knows exactly how dangerous she can be.
